Lab Assistant Interview Questions

The goal for a successful interview for Lab Assistant is to demonstrate their ability to accurately conduct lab tests, prepare samples, and maintain lab equipment.

Situational interview questions

  • Imagine you receive a sample with unexpected results. Walk me through your process for troubleshooting the issue to determine a potential solution.
  • A researcher approaches you with a complex experimental design that requires thorough documentation. How would you ensure accuracy and completeness throughout the process?
  • You notice a potential safety hazard within the lab. Describe your approach to addressing the issue and mitigating risk for both yourself and others.
  • You are responsible for maintaining lab equipment, including troubleshooting problems as they arise. Describe a situation in which you identified an issue with a piece of equipment and the steps you took to resolve it.
  • Communication is a crucial part of working in a lab environment. Describe a time when you had to navigate a difficult conversation or provide feedback to a colleague or supervisor. What specific strategies did you use to handle the situation?

Soft skills interview questions

  • How do you prioritize your workload and manage your time effectively as a Lab Assistant?
  • Describe a situation where you had to communicate a complex scientific concept to a non-scientist. How did you approach the situation?
  • Tell us about a time when you had to work with a difficult colleague or supervisor. How did you manage the situation?
  • Give an example of how you have demonstrated attention to detail in your previous work as a Lab Assistant?
  • Can you describe a successful collaboration effort you were a part of in a prior work experience? What was your contribution to the project’s success?

Role-specific interview questions

  • Can you explain the process you would use to prepare and sterilize laboratory equipment?
  • Please tell us about a time when you encountered a difficult sample or specimen in the lab and what steps you took to analyze it.
  • How do you ensure compliance with safety regulations and best practices in a laboratory setting?
  • In your opinion, what are the most important qualities for a lab assistant to possess, and how do you embody those qualities?
  • Can you walk us through a project or experiment you worked on in a previous lab assistant role, highlighting your contributions and outcomes?
